The 1824 House Inn invites you to join hands and hearts
and celebrate your love in Vermont’s Mad River Valley.
Reminiscent of its farming roots, this
graceful country farmhouse and beautifully
restored 19th century
post-and-beam barn, set on 15 pastoral
acres, is a picture perfect backdrop to a
Vermont wedding or civil union.
Imagine your wedding
celebration in an enchanting barn or high
peaked tent. Or, best of all, enjoy both.
The manicured back pasture is ideally suited
for tented events, and our fully modernized
barn - still with the right amount of rustic
charm – is a magnificent complement. Let
your guests enjoy cocktails in the elegantly
lit barn, with a string trio playing from
the hayloft, and then move to the tent for a
delectable sit down meal.
Return to the barn
for music and dancing – the wide planked
floors and warm lighting make it fun and
easy to dance the night away. Plus, the barn
is equipped with a rich wood bar, comfortable bathrooms, making it a
great stand-alone venue for ceremonies,
receptions, or rehearsal dinners.
If an outdoor ceremony is
in your dreams we have several romantic
sites. A tree encircled knoll along the
banks of the north-flowing Mad River or the
upper meadow, with its panoramic views.
